~ OUR ADOPTION PROCESS ~

1. We ask that you fill in our Adoption Application before we make arrangements to meet a cat or kitten. This will help us to match you the best suited cat or kitten.

2. We will conduct an Interview via phone or video chat if your application is successful.
3. We will invite you to a meet and greet at a time that suits you and our foster carer.
4. If it is a purrfect match for cat and hooman, you will need to:
- Pay the adoption fee as listed. We accept direct deposit or cash.
- Sign our final adoption agreement and send it back to us
- We will conduct a house check and drop off your new friend. We carry out house checks to ensure that there aren't any escape routes, or toxic plants etc.
- We prefer our cats to remain indoors at all times for their safety and the safety of wildlife and are only outside if they have access to a cat run our are outside with supervision.
